Introdução
Os tokens não‑fungíveis (NFTs) revolucionaram o modo como criadores, artistas e colecionadores interagem com ativos digitais. Se você já ouviu falar de obras de arte vendidas por milhões de dólares ou de coleções de cards virtuais que valorizam rapidamente, provavelmente se perguntou como criar seu próprio NFT. Este guia completo, atualizado para 2025, oferece um passo a passo técnico, desde a escolha da blockchain até a publicação (mint) do token, passando por aspectos de segurança, custos e estratégias de venda.
- Entenda o que realmente é um NFT e suas propriedades únicas.
- Escolha a blockchain mais adequada ao seu perfil e orçamento.
- Configure uma carteira digital segura e conecte‑a a um marketplace.
- Prepare o arquivo digital (imagem, áudio, vídeo ou código).
- Execute o processo de mintagem, pagando as taxas de gas.
- Liste seu NFT para venda e acompanhe métricas de mercado.
O que é um NFT?
Um NFT (Non‑Fungible Token) é um token criptográfico que representa a propriedade ou a autenticidade de um ativo digital único. Diferente das criptomoedas como Bitcoin ou Ether, que são fungíveis (troca‑por‑troca), cada NFT possui um identificador exclusivo e metadados que descrevem seu conteúdo, proprietário e histórico de transações.
Características técnicas
Os NFTs são normalmente implementados usando o padrão ERC‑721 ou ERC‑1155 (para tokens semi‑fungíveis) na rede Ethereum, embora outras blockchains como Solana, Polygon, Binance Smart Chain e Tezos ofereçam padrões equivalentes (ex.: SPL Token, BEP‑721). Cada token contém:
- ID único: um número inteiro ou hash que o diferencia de todos os demais.
- Metadados: um JSON armazenado on‑chain ou off‑chain (IPFS, Arweave) que inclui nome, descrição, URL da mídia e atributos.
- Propriedade: o endereço da carteira que detém o token.
Escolhendo a Blockchain Ideal
A escolha da blockchain impacta diretamente nas taxas de gas, na velocidade de confirmação e na compatibilidade com marketplaces. As opções mais populares no Brasil em 2025 são:
- Ethereum (ETH): maior liquidez, mas taxas elevadas (R$ 20‑200 por mint, dependendo da congestão).
- Polygon (MATIC): camada de segunda‑nível do Ethereum, taxas quase nulas (menos de R$ 1) e suporte a ERC‑721.
- Solana (SOL): alta performance, custos de transação muito baixos (cerca de R$ 0,10).
- Tezos (XTZ): foco em sustentabilidade, taxas moderadas e boa aceitação em marketplaces de arte.
Para iniciantes que desejam experimentar sem gastar muito, Polygon costuma ser a escolha mais equilibrada. Caso você busque maior visibilidade em coleções de alto valor, Ethereum ainda lidera.
Configurando a Carteira Digital
Uma carteira digital (wallet) é essencial para armazenar criptomoedas, pagar gas e receber a propriedade do NFT. As opções mais usadas são:
- MetaMask: extensão de navegador compatível com Ethereum, Polygon e outras EVMs.
- Trust Wallet: app mobile que suporta múltiplas blockchains, ideal para quem usa smartphones.
- Phantom: wallet focada em Solana.
- Temple Wallet: para Tezos.
Procedimento de configuração:
- Instale a extensão ou aplicativo da wallet escolhida.
- Crie uma nova conta, anotando a seed phrase (12‑24 palavras) em um local seguro.
- Adicione a rede desejada (ex.: Polygon) nas configurações avançadas.
- Compre ou transfira a criptomoeda nativa da rede (MATIC, ETH, SOL ou XTZ) para cobrir as taxas de mintagem.
Preparando o Arquivo Digital
O NFT pode representar qualquer tipo de mídia digital: imagens (PNG, JPEG, GIF), áudio (MP3, WAV), vídeo (MP4, WEBM) ou até mesmo código e objetos 3D (GLB, OBJ). Algumas boas práticas:
- Resolução: para arte visual, mantenha no máximo 4k (3840×2160) para garantir qualidade sem inflar o tamanho.
- Tamanho máximo: a maioria dos marketplaces aceita até 100 MB; arquivos maiores podem exigir compressão ou armazenamento em camada de segunda camada.
- Direitos autorais: garanta que você possui ou tem licença para usar o conteúdo.
- Armazenamento descentralizado: utilize IPFS (InterPlanetary File System) ou Arweave para garantir que o arquivo permaneça acessível mesmo que o servidor original caia.
Exemplo de fluxo para armazenar a mídia no IPFS:
- Instale o
ipfs-cliou use um serviço como Pinata. - Execute
ipfs add seu_arquivo.pnge copie o CID resultante. - Inclua o CID no campo
imagedos metadados JSON.
Mintando o NFT
Mintar significa registrar o token na blockchain, criando assim o NFT. Existem duas abordagens principais:
- Mintagem manual via contrato inteligente: programadores interagem diretamente com o código Solidity (ou Rust, se for Solana).
- Mintagem através de marketplaces: plataformas como OpenSea, Rarible ou Magic Eden oferecem interfaces “drag‑and‑drop” que criam o contrato por você.
Mintagem manual (exemplo em Ethereum)
Pré‑requisitos: Node.js, Hardhat, ethers.js e uma wallet com ETH.
// 1. Instale dependências
npm install --save-dev hardhat @nomiclabs/hardhat-ethers ethers
// 2. Crie o contrato ERC‑721
// contracts/MeuNFT.sol
pragma solidity ^0.8.0;
import "@openzeppelin/contracts/token/ERC721/extensions/ERC721URIStorage.sol";
import "@openzeppelin/contracts/access/Ownable.sol";
contract MeuNFT is ERC721URIStorage, Ownable {
uint256 public tokenCounter;
constructor() ERC721("MeuNFT", "MNFT") {
tokenCounter = 0;
}
function criarNFT(string memory tokenURI) public onlyOwner returns (uint256) {
uint256 newItemId = tokenCounter;
_safeMint(msg.sender, newItemId);
_setTokenURI(newItemId, tokenURI);
tokenCounter = tokenCounter + 1;
return newItemId;
}
}
Após compilar e implantar o contrato, chame a função criarNFT passando a URL dos metadados (ex.: ipfs://CID/metadata.json). Cada chamada gera uma transação que consome gas.
Mintagem via OpenSea (Polygon)
Passos simplificados:
- Acesse OpenSea e conecte sua carteira.
- Clique em “Create” → “Create a collection”.
- Preencha nome, descrição e imagem da coleção.
- Dentro da coleção, escolha “Add New Item”.
- Upload da mídia, preencha atributos e clique “Create”.
- Assine a transação de mintagem (custo ~R$ 0,50 em Polygon).
OpenSea cuida da criação do contrato inteligente por trás, ideal para quem não tem experiência em programação.
Custos e Taxas (Gas Fees)
Os custos variam conforme a rede e a congestão. Em novembro de 2025, os valores médios são:
- Ethereum: R$ 120‑200 por mint (dependendo do preço do ETH, ~0,005‑0,01 ETH).
- Polygon: R$ 0,30‑1,00 (0,0005‑0,002 MATIC).
- Solana: R$ 0,10‑0,30 (0,00003‑0,0001 SOL).
- Tezos: R$ 0,50‑2,00 (0,001‑0,004 XTZ).
Lembre‑se de manter um saldo extra na carteira para cobrir eventuais falhas de transação.
Melhores Práticas de Segurança
Segurança é fundamental para proteger tanto seus fundos quanto a integridade do NFT:
- Use hardware wallets (Ledger, Trezor) para armazenar a seed phrase.
- Verifique URLs antes de conectar a wallets em sites de mintagem.
- Não compartilhe sua seed phrase com ninguém, nem mesmo com suporte técnico.
- Audite contratos quando usar código próprio ou de terceiros.
- Faça backup dos metadados em múltiplos serviços (IPFS + Arweave).
Como Vender ou Listar seu NFT
Depois de mintado, você pode colocar o NFT à venda em marketplaces. As etapas gerais são:
- Abra o marketplace de sua escolha (OpenSea, Rarible, Magic Eden, Objkt).
- Localize seu NFT na carteira conectada.
- Clique em “Sell” ou “List for Sale”.
- Defina preço fixo (em ETH, MATIC, SOL, etc.) ou modelo de leilão.
- Aprovação de contrato: autorize o marketplace a transferir seu token quando vendido.
- Assine a transação de listagem (custo de aprovação, geralmente < R$ 1).
Após a venda, o marketplace retém uma taxa de serviço (geralmente 2,5% a 5%). O valor líquido será enviado para sua carteira.
FAQs Técnicas
Confira as dúvidas mais recorrentes dos criadores de NFT no Brasil.
Qual a diferença entre ERC‑721 e ERC‑1155?
ERC‑721 representa tokens totalmente únicos, enquanto ERC‑1155 permite combinar tokens únicos e semi‑fungíveis em um único contrato, reduzindo custos de gas quando você emite múltiplos itens simultaneamente.
Posso mudar a imagem de um NFT depois de mintado?
Não diretamente. O link de imagem está armazenado nos metadados imutáveis. Se quiser atualizar, crie um novo NFT ou use contratos que suportem “upgradable metadata” (ex.: ERC‑721 com função setTokenURI restrita ao proprietário).
É obrigatório usar IPFS?
Não, mas é altamente recomendado. Armazenar a mídia em servidores centralizados pode gerar links quebrados se o provedor sair do ar, comprometendo a permanência do seu NFT.
Conclusão
Crear um NFT hoje combina criatividade, conhecimento técnico e atenção a custos e segurança. Ao seguir este guia passo a passo, você pode transformar qualquer obra digital em um token verificável, pronto para ser negociado nos maiores marketplaces globais. Lembre‑se de manter sua carteira segura, monitorar as taxas de gas e, sobretudo, respeitar os direitos autorais. Com prática, você evoluirá de criador iniciante a especialista, contribuindo para o vibrante ecossistema de NFTs no Brasil e no mundo.